It actually was a great day in the end. It is a nature researve near a nuclear power plant so don't go in the water ;). There are several routes you can take and some are very accessible. We are doing the #30dayswild so loved spotting the snails, slugs and newts we found. Also they had a bug house. So a hit with Bug!
They have a little shop and you can get some treats there. Dogs are allowed and there are toilets.
In nearby Dungeness, there is a little train (which I didn't know about) and a lighthouse that you can visit- so I will have to do that next time as Bug and I were soaked by then!
